Biomass Boiler and District Heat Installation Opportunity

Companies are invited to tender for the installation of a biomass boiler at Upper and Lower Coombe Farms near Litton Cheney in Dorset. This opportunity involves the installation of a biomass boiler, buffer tank, plant room, district heat scheme, heat exchangers and a heat meter. The works will include installation, commissioning and RHI application.

Over the last 15 years, the community at Hilfield Friary in Dorchester have been working hard to make their land and buildings more climate friendly.

A grant from Low Carbon Dorset for solar panels has helped the community get even closer to their net zero goals.
